- Casse-cro?te
- "break bread"; slang for snack.
- Casseron
- cuttlefish.
- Cassis (cr?me de)
- black currant (black currant liqueur).
- Cassolette
- usually a dish presented in a small casserole.
- Cassonade
- soft brown sugar; demerara sugar.
- Cassoulet
- popular southwestern casserole of white beans, including various combinations of sausages, duck, pork, lamb, mutton, and goose.
- Cavaillon
- a town in Provence, known for its small, flavorful orange-fleshed melons.
- Caviar d'aubergine
- cold seasoned eggplant puree.
- Caviar du Puy
- green lentils from Le Puy, in the Auvergne.
- Cebiche
- seviche; generally raw fish marinated in lime juice and other seasonings.
- Cendre (sous la)
- ash (cooked by being buried in embers); some cheeses made in wine-producing regions are aged in the ash of burned rootstocks.
- Cerdon
- Bubbly (p?tillant) wine (red or white?) from the Bugey.
- Cerf
- stag, or male deer.
- Cerfeuil
- chervil.
- Cerise
- cherry.
